On Fri, Jan 25, 2019 at 3:20 PM Cinaed Simson <cinaed.sim...@gmail.com> wrote: > It bothered me that the random source wasn't working. > > So I took at it again last night and discovered I needed to unpack a bit > from the random source stream. > > Using the random source, the following work: > > BPSK > QPSK > 8PSK > 16QAM > > using the pull down menu. > > There is, however, one caveat: for 8PSK you have to enable the complex > Multiply Const by -1 block after the Chunks to Symbols block. > > Alternatively, you could change Chunks to Symbols from -1,1 to 1,-1 - > but that's many more key strokes then just enabling and disabling the > Multiply Const block. > > They all work with the GLFSR source too and with the same caveat. > > And you were right you don't need the PSK symbol table - you can use > Chunks to Symbols -1,1 (except for 8PKS.) > > Also, I had to add a unpack k=1 block after the decoder - otherwise for > DPSK, 8PSK and 16QAM there was a vertical offset and BER sky rockets. > > The unpack k=1 is not needed for BPSK and QPSK - but it doesn't create > any problems so I left it enabled. > > You just need to add the complex noise source > > Have fun with QT. > > Actually, there is already a QT menu - the properties of Constellation > Object.
